Q: Why does Gatewing return 429s even when upstream load looks fine?

A: Gatewing enforces per-tenant token buckets, not global throughput. A single tenant bursting past its quota trips 429s regardless of cluster headroom. Check the tenant's bucket config before raising limits; most incidents are misconfigured batch jobs. Quota overrides expire after 24 hours by design. The full limits matrix lives on the page below.

operations page: https://jenkins.zemvarcloud.local/job/merge_requests/repo/build/73930b4b30f0a8ed

- [ ] Collect the sealed score sheets from the Velmare Regional Chess Final at the Arbiter's table in Dunhollow Hall before 18:30. Confirm each envelope is signed across the flap by the chief arbiter, count all twelve boards' sheets, and log them in the run folder. The courier hand-over instruction for this run follows below.

dispatch memo: the quenvan holax courier leaves the zoreth briath kasvan ledger at gate 7481 under passcode 618862

The Pinemarsh digest job assembles daily summary emails for all active workspaces and runs at 05:30 UTC via the Cronhollow scheduler. If digests are late, first check the scheduler dashboard for a skipped tick, then verify the queue depth on the Mailspruce relay — anything over 10k means the previous run stalled. To requeue manually, call the Mailspruce batch endpoint with the affected workspace range. That endpoint requires service authentication, and requests should be signed with the internal key below.

gateway credential: kto23_LX9A4ys6i4nzHtpOLNLodKK

Ticket FM-3190: Heads up — we're running a pop-up office at the Verano Expo Hall for the Lanternfall trade fair next week. Reception staff rotating through the booth should grab the portable kit (banner, tablet stand, lanyards) from storage room 2 before Tuesday. The expo organisers gave us a small lockable back office behind booth 14 for bags and spare stock. Keep it locked whenever unattended. The door unit on that back office takes the code below.

badge for yahag-yajep: bdg-N-77